Output 91a58c30cf4eda81448b7d4c78f5418f2ff0487315ff70ca9013adc43e9cb439:2

value
21641650
script pubkey
OP_0 OP_PUSHBYTES_20 59e90dfd56511caa8a7836a52b454e97b965bc76
address
ltc1qt85sml2k2yw24zncx6jjk32wj7ukt0rkmug3ys
transaction
91a58c30cf4eda81448b7d4c78f5418f2ff0487315ff70ca9013adc43e9cb439
spent
true